The armada atomic_check implementation uses the deprecated
drm_atomic_get_existing_crtc_state() helper.

This hook is called as part of the global atomic_check, thus before the
states are swapped. The existing state thus points to the new state, and
we can use drm_atomic_get_new_crtc_state() instead.
